Recreational Therapist jobs in Lima, OH

Recreational Therapist plans and directs medically approved therapeutic recreational programs for patients. Organizes activities according to patients' capabilities, needs, and interests. Being a Recreational Therapist conducts programs including symptom management, basic conversation skills, community re-entry, sports, gardening, dramatics, music, social activities, and arts and crafts. Prepares reports for patients' physicians describing individual patient symptoms and reactions to therapeutic programs. Additionally, Recreational Therapist conducts activity therapy assessment of a patient's strengths and needs, and recommends therapeutic activity. Documents progress on each patient. Requires a license/certification to practice from the National Council of Therapeutic Recreation Specialists.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ager.     Position Description:

    As a member of the treatment team, The Therapist provides mental health and substance abuse counseling on an individual basis, and in-group settings. Provides assessment, treatment planning, and documentation in accordance with hospital standards.

    Responsibilities:

    1. Interviews patients, families and significant others, and evaluates the precipitating admission factors, emotional and psychological problems, available personal/community support systems, relevant family dynamics and financial/legal issues.

    2. Determines specific disabilities and capabilities of each patient.

    3. Develops therapeutic relationships with patients and significant others.

    4. Assists in the formulation, implementation, evaluation, and modification of a clinically sound plan of care for assigned patients in conjunction with the attending psychiatrist.

    5. Assess and follows-up on issues, concerning patients’ rights as related to the emergency admissions procedures, involuntary placement, etc.

    6. Formulates therapeutic relationships, provides and/or facilitates groups, marital, family psychotherapy, patient education and/or individual psychotherapy as prescribed by the specific treatment protocol.

    7. Coordinates discharge planning with families, program treatment team, agencies, and other community resources.

    8. Participation as a vital member of the multi-disciplinary treatment team through consultation with team members regarding patient care.

    9. Interfaces with families and physicians in resolving problems associated with the patient’s admission and ongoing hospitalization.

    10. Participates in the establishment and maintenance of a full range of resources and information pertinent to the treatment plan.

    11. Completes and utilizes all relevant documentation.

    12. Contributes to the development of the respective professional discipline role within the department. Promotes a therapeutic milieu.

    13. Selects and uses a comprehensive assessment process that is sensitive to age, gender, racial and ethnic, cultural issues.

    14. Establishes accurate treatment and recovery expectations with the client and involved significant others.

    15. Facilitates the client’s engagement in treatment and recovery process. Works with the client to establish realistic achievable goals with achieving and maintaining recovery.

    16. Provides therapy in compliance with internal policies, external governing statues, and guideline including the JCAHO and Medicare.

Lima (/ˈlaɪmə/ LY-mə) is a city in and the county seat of Allen County, Ohio, United States. The municipality is located in northwestern Ohio along Interstate 75 approximately 72 miles (116 km) north of Dayton and 78 miles (126 km) south-southwest of Toledo. As of the 2010 census, the city had a population of 38,771. It is the principal city of and is included in the Lima, Ohio metropolitan statistical area, which is included in the Lima–Van Wert–Wapakoneta, OH, combined statistical area. Lima was founded in 1831. The Lima Army Tank Plant, built in 1941, is the sole producer of the M1 Abrams....
